ZK Rollup


A Zero-Knowledge (ZK) rollup is a Layer-2 scaling solution for blockchains, particularly designed to improve scalability and reduce transaction costs. Blockchains like Ethereum have limited transaction throughput due to their consensus mechanisms, and Layer-2 solutions aim to process transactions and store state data off-chain or in a separate layer before settling them on the mainchain, thereby increasing scalability.

ZK proofs are cryptographic methods that allow one party (the prover) to prove to another party (the verifier) that a statement is true without revealing any additional information beyond the validity of the statement itself. In the context of ZK rollups, ZK-SNARKs are used to prove the correctness of off-chain computations without revealing the actual data being computed.

ZK rollups bundle multiple transactions off-chain, compute their results, and then submit a single compressed proof (ZK-SNARK) to the mainchain, which verifies the correctness of the computations without needing to process each transaction individually.
